What is the solution to this system of equations?

2/3x + y = 6

-2/3x - y = 2

A. (1, -1)
B. (0, 8)
C. infinitely many solutions
D. no solution

Answers

Answer 1
D. No solution since the two lines have the same slope. 
Answer 2
Final answer:

When the given system of equations is added together, it simplifies to '0=8', which is a contradiction. Therefore, the system of equations has no solution.

Explanation:

You can simply add the two equations together. Adding the two equations eliminates the variables x and y:

(2/3x - 2/3x) + (y - y) = 6 + 2

This simplifies to 0 = 8, which is a contradiction. Therefore, this system of equations has no solution. That means the correct answer is D. 'No solution'.

which of the following functions is continuous between x=-3 and x=0? choices on attachment

Answers

When we say that a function is continuous between x = -3 and x = 0 it means that it exists for all values of x in between -3 and 0. Let's take a look at each choice individually:

A: f(x) = (-x + 1)/(x + 2)
Now we don't actually need to know what the graph of this function looks like to see which values it is continuous for, instead we should look at which values of x will make this function undefined - in this case that would be x = -2. The reasoning behind this is that a number divided by 0 would be undefined, so when we search for which value of x would make the denominator of the equation 0, we get:
x + 2 = 0
x = -2
Since x = -2 is within the interval [-3, 0] we cannot say the function is continuous over this interval

B: f(x) = -2/(x + 1)
Using the same method as above we get:
x + 1 = 0
x = -1
x = -1 is again within the interval [-3, 0] and so the function is not continuous within this interval

C: f(x) = 3x/(x - 2)
x - 2 = 0
x = 2
x = 2 is outside the interval of [-3, 0] and so the function is continuous within this interval and C is the correct answer.

Just for the sake of it however we can look at D as well:
D: f(x) = 1/(2x + 1)
2x + 1 = 0
x = -1/2
-1/2 is within [-3, 0] and so D is not continuous over this interval

Suppose q and r are independent events, and P(Q)= 0.39, P(R)= 0.85. Find P(q and r)

Answers

Answer:
P (q and r) = 0.3315

Explanation:
We are given that:
P (q) = 0.39
P (r) = 0.85

Since the two events are independent, therefore, the formula that we will use to get P (q and r) is as follows:
P (q and r) = P (q) * P (r)

Based on the givens:
P (q and r) = 0.39 * 0.85 = 0.3315

Hope this helps :)
